About AUSAFA
The need for AUSAFA was first identified in August 2007 when representatives from numerous African USAF agencies and regulatory authorities met in Nairobi, Kenya. The representatives agreed that a formal association would help their respective agencies work towards their common goal. The idea was further developed in Pataya, Thailand in March 2008 and at several CTO events around Africa. By August 2008, the consensus among USAF agencies and telecommunications stakeholders for the establishment of AUSAFA led to the forming of AUSAFA on the 26th of August 2008 in Lilongwe, Malawi where representatives of 12 Universal Service and Access Funds (USAFs) issued a Declaration, adopted the Constitution of AUSAFA and elected the office bearers.
As the secretariat for AUSAFA, the CTO coordinates the work of the Association and allows its members to leverage its institutional knowledge, its reach within the Global ICT sector and its relationships with numerous ICT stakeholders.
For the year 2008-09 AUSAFA governance is carried out by:
AUSAFA Office | Name | Title |
Chairman | Mr. Bob Lyazi | Director of the Rural Communications Development Fund, Uganda |
First Vice Chairman | Mr. Abraham Kofi Asante | Administrator of the Ghana Investment Fund for Telecommunications (GIFTEL) |
Second Vice Chairman | Mr. Phineas Moleele | Acting CEO of the Universal Service and Access Agency of South Africa |
